Hollywood film star Robert Wagner not a suspect

(Reuters) - Homicide detectives who have reopened an inquiry into the death Natalie Wood said on Friday that the film star's husband, actor Robert Wagner, was not considered a suspect in the case.


The new investigation was opened into Wood's 1981 drowning off the California coast after a yacht captain said that he lied about the incident three decades ago and now holds Wagner responsible for her death.

Los Angeles County Sheriff's Homicide Lt. John Corina told reporters at a news conference on Friday that the original finding that Wood's death was an accidental drowning had not changed.

But detectives had reopened the investigation based on new information from several sources "which we felt was substantial enough to make us take another look at this case," Corina said.

Asked by reporters if Wagner, who is now 81, was considered a suspect, Corina responded: "No."

GWAR guitarist dead-Band continues tour

Fans of GWAR, the shock rock speed metal band known for its monstrous costumes, are mourning the loss of their guitarist Cory Smoot, who was found dead Thursday while the band was traveling to Canada for an upcoming show. Smoot, known to fans as the character Flattus Maximus, had been a member of the band since 2002.

According to the Associated Press, Smoots age and cause of death are unclear. Smoot was the sixth guitarist to play the role of Flattus Maximus, and in taking the role, he became a part of the the band’s theatrical onstage mythology. To see a GWAR concert is to see a series of comically gory vignettes, acted out by musicians in monstrous costumes that may have been inspired by the creatures of H.P. Lovecraft.

Daylight Saving Time ends on 6th November 2011

Since 2007, Daylight Saving Time, or DST for short, begins on the second Sunday in March and ends on the first Sunday in November.

November 6 is the first Sunday in November this year, so you will turn your clocks back one hour at 2:00 Sunday morning, November 6.

The movie "Courageous" is on top of the sales list at Fandago

“Courageous,” a film about four police officers attempting to be good fathers and maintain their Christian faith, may be the most popular new movie release of the weekend.

The new movie — which opens on 1,161 screens in the USA was co-written and directed by Alex Kendrick, the filmmaker behind past faith-based films such as “Fireproof” and “Facing the Giants” — is leading advance sales on Fandango throughout the whole week, according to data provided by the online ticket retailer.

As of this morning, purchases for “Courageous” accounted for 26% of the transactions on the site; the only other new release that comes close is “50/50,” which was in fourth place with 7%.

Sly Stone now living in van & homeless

The former funk singer, who fronted the group Sly & the Family Stone, opened up to The New York Post over the weekend about how his use of drugs and money mismanagement have led him to a homeless life on the road.Stone had this to say about the van, according to the paper:
"I like my small camper," he says, his voice raspy with age and years of hard living. "I just do not want to return to a fixed home. I cannot stand being in one place. I must keep moving."
Stone records music on a laptop computer inside the van. The Post reports Stone is paranoid and thinks the FBI is after him.

Stone tells the Post he started having serious money problems in 2009, stemming from a bad management contract he signed in 1989. He has sued the manager with whom he made that deal.

The 68 year old parks the vehicle in a residential street in the notoriously rough Los Angeles neighborhood of Crenshaw, where a retired couple provides him with a warm meal each day and use of a shower.

HP got a new CEO?! Meg Whitman replacing Leo Apotheker rumors

Former eBay CEO and former California gubernatorial candidate Meg Whitman may be on deck for the top slot at Hewlett-Packard, if anonymous sources and current rumors  are right.

Current CEO Léo Apotheker has been at the post for about a year, but the company has had a run of bad luck in recent months. Hp Stock dropped 43% also another reason to believe the rumors.

In considering Ms. Whitman, H-P is looking to a Silicon Valley veteran who turned eBay Inc. from a quirky start-up into the world's leading online auction company and who remains an influential figure in the technology scene as an H-P director and an adviser to a leading venture-capital firm.

But the former eBay chief executive also has little background in the hardware industry, never ran a company of H-P's size, made some missteps at eBay and most recently drew attention for a failed bid to become governor of California.

In an interview Monday, Ms. Meg Whitman, 55, described H-P as "a Silicon Valley icon that is the process of reshaping itself." She acknowledged that the Palo Alto, Calif., company "has certainly had challenges" and that "time will tell" how it fares, but she added, "I'm optimistic about H-P's future."

In addition to stock losses and the webOS problems, the company also had to lay off 100,000 workers in the Palm division. Prior to Leo Apotheker’s appointment, former CEO Mark Hurd resigned under pressure after a sexual harassment investigation as well as various accusations about expense reports related to the claim. The board found no evidence to support the harassment claims.

Don´t ask; don´t tell ending after holding for 18 long years

Tuesday, the day that the military "don't ask, don't tell" policy was officially repealed, was remarkable mostly for how normal it was. The military went about its business. The wars in Iraq and Afghanistan went on. The Pentagon had long since finished its preparations; it had even begun recruiting openly gay people to enlist once the repeal took effect.

Pentagon officials for their part stressed that they believe sexual orientation remains “a personal and private matter.” When asked what will happen Tuesday if a gay individual walks into a recruiting station today and wants to join the military, Pentagon spokesman George Little noted that “while applicants are not asked, or required to reveal their sexual orientation, statements about sexual orientation will not be a bar to military service.

But the end of "don't ask, don't tell" -- a Clinton-era policy that forbade gay service members from disclosing their sexual orientation and their officers from asking about it -- was tremendously consequential for the service members affected by it, and also politically.

Legacy of Tupak Shakur still living on

Even 15 years after Tupak Shakur´s death on the 13th September 1996 his legacy is still living on.
He was shot in Las Vegas watching a boxing match at the MGM.

One of Pac's greatest qualities was his ability to compliment emcees on the microphone, and the artistic mentality he carried often reflected on the performance of those around him.

Born to two Black Panthers, Tupac understood poverty and black struggle, and he wasn't afraid to express it through his music. As intelligent, profound and articulate as he was in song, 'Pac also remained relatable, controversial and contradictory. So while tracks like "Brenda's Got a Baby," "Keep Ya Head Up" and "Dear Mama" were made to uplift, fiery anthems like "Hit 'Em Up," "Ambitionz Az a Ridah" and "Against All Odds" stood as chest-pounding, testosterone-filled thug anthems. Other hits like "I Get Around," "How Do U Want It" and "Toss It Up" celebrated Tupac's flirtatious side.

After his death, Tupac's legacy lives, particularly with the eight albums that have been released, including a double-disc greatest hits collection. He has been immortalized in film, books and even college courses, as well as through the works of musicians who have come after him. Traces of 'Pac can be found in nearly almost every rapper from 50 Cent to T.I. Jay-Z, Eminem, and others - all sampled from Shakur.


In his death he has remained firmly rooted as a hip-hop legend, but at the same time his legend has surpassed musical genre. Tupac Shakur was more than a rapper or poet or a thespian; he is a motivator, an inspiration to all of us -- even in death.

Serena Williams wins 6-3 & 6-4 against Ana Ivanovic

Serena Williams won her 4th round match agains Ana Ivanovic and advances into the quarterfinals. It was quite an easy win though it did not start good for Williams.

Ivanovic, the 16th seed, struggled on her serve throughout the match at a blustery Arthur Ashe Stadium, successful with only 51% of her first serves and winning only 29% of points on her second. Twenty-nine unforced errors and eight double faults by the Serb made the task easier for Williams, who will face Anastasia Pavlyuchenkova, the 17th seed from Russia, in the quarterfinals

A lone break of the Ivanovic serve proved the difference in the second set and, although the 23-year-old improved as the match continued, the errors remained and Williams completed victory after one hour and 17 minutes when the Serb fired a forehand long.

Venus Williams is out of the US Open in 2nd round

The tennis star Venus Williams retreated in the 2nd round of the US Open. ESPN says the reason given was an "unspecified illness," canceling her second-round match just minutes before it was set to begin

She actually commited to be diagnosticed with the Sjögren's Syndrome, an autoimmune disease which is an ongoing medical condition that affects her energy level and causes fatigue and joint pain.

She entered the tournament as the world's 36th-ranked player after playing just 11 matches this year.

The withdraw now takes her below the top 100´s and is the first time since 1996.

It is still unclear if she will be able to return to the court.

MTV´s VMA 2011: Beyonce is pregnant and Tyler, the Creater wins best new artist

Los Angeles was well-represented in the MTV Video Music Awards field for best new artist, with Odd Future leader Tyler, the Creator facing off against electronic-pop act Foster the People. However, Tyler won the award for the best new artist.

When Tyler gave his speech he admitted that he did not prepare one and dreamed of winning a MTV trophy since he was 9. He received the award for his single "Yonkers" from his solo album "Goblin".

Ealier, Beyonce perfomed "Love on Top" and releaved that she was pregant.

Indianapolis Colts taking retired Kerry Collins

Kerry Collins seems to be getting hot again in the NFL. THe Indianapolis Colts hired him and made an agreement with him. He was a retired quaterback who is now back and playing for the Indianapolis Colts.

Collins has been signed late in the summer before, also on a semi-emergency basis. In 2006 the Titans brought him aboard on Aug. 28 when Billy Volek was struggling and Vince Young was a rookie. The crash course on Tennessee's offense didn't go well, as Collins was 0-3 as a starter before being benched. But, to be fair, his top receivers were Drew Bennett and Bobby Wade, not Reggie Wayne and Dallas Clark

It looks like Kerry Collins is getting compared with Brett Favre because he has come out of retirement to be Peyton Manning´s substitue or possible replacement.
